ENGLAND-1969: British soldiers in iconic red tunics and tall black bearskin hats stand outside Buckingham Palace, their ceremonial uniforms detailed with gold trim and white belts. Shot through dark vertical bars, the footage captures a moment of quiet interaction among the guards against the stone facade of the royal residence. The 8mm film exhibits natural grain and color saturation typical of home movies from the late 1960s, offering a nostalgic glimpse into royal guard duty during a bygone era.
